This chapter describes disassembly and assembly (Assemble document please look up from the last page), please follow the information provided in this section to perform the complete disassembly procedure.
♦ Precautions:
Before you perform any service or repair on the notebook, please pay special attention to the cautions prevent any damages to the notebook.
Please prepare and select the appropriate tools to disassemble/assemble for the VIVOBOOK X1503ZA notebook.
♦ Screwdriver
Please accord to different screw specification to choose different screwdriver and head.
♦ Plastic Blade
♦ Tweezers ( Tweezer material: Metal and Plastic)
Use a pair of tweezers to remove/insert/tidy cables.
♦ Thickness Gauge
Thickness compass specification 0.05mm-1.5mm. Use it to measure the gap.
♦ Magnetism Board
Suggest local buy magnetism board to place screw, avoid mix different type screw to cause assembly damage.

Disassembly Notice Please be sure to pull out adapter and disconnect the battery.
Before disassembly battery connector, please be sure to pull out adapter and disconnect the battery more than ten seconds in order to IC damage.
Step 1 : Use the non-conductive pry tool to push iron sheet.
Step 2 : Use the non-conductive pry tool to disconnect battery connector.
Note : Please disconnect the red cable side first.
Assembly Notice
To prevent getting a short circuit or an electric shock accident, please follow the below steps to connect the battery connector.
Step 1 : Use the non-conductive pry tool to connect the black cable side first, then connect the red cable side.
Step 2 : Use the non-conductive pry tool to push the iron sheet.

Disassembly Notice Please be sure to pull out adapter and disconnect the battery.
Step 1 : Remove the screw *4pcs.
Step 2 : Remove the THERMAL MODULE.
Recommend that the force point is at green block, pull up thermal module to take it out. Do not pull up at red block and note the thermal pipe should not have deformation.

Disassembly Notice Please be sure to pull out adapter and disconnect the battery.
Step 1 : Remove the hinge cap.
Step 2 : Remove screw mylar *2pcs and then remove screw *2pcs(red mark).
Step 3 : Remove LCD BEZEL.
Step 3-1~3-4, please follow the below picture to remove the bezel, Due to some tapes behind the lower edge of bezel, please using plastic blade to teardown the bezel. Please follow the direction shown in the red arrow, to move plastic blade from left to right and peel the bezel away slowly. While peeling, please move the blade in the parallel direction to the panel and pressing the black Mylar downward (As circled in green) to ensure the black Mylar and the tape behind the bezel are well separated.
Please move blade slowly to separate the bezel away, and must press the black Mylar downward with panel parallel direction.
Assembly Notice
When reuse the LCD BEZEL:
Please paste new LCD BEZEL ADHESIVE before assembly BEZEL. (New LCD BEZEL already contains LCD BEZEL ADHESIVE 4pcs)
For LCD BEZEL assembly, please remember to paste new screw mylar *2pcs after assembling on the LCD BEZEL.
For LCD BEZEL assembly, Please follow the steps below to paste sponge *2pcs before assembling BEZEL.
For LCD BEZEL assembly, please follow the steps below paste BEZEL ADH MYLAR *2pcs before assembling.
